Johnson & Johnson Services Inc., a member of the Johnson & Johnson family of companies is recruiting for an Analyst, MedTech Supply Chain User Access Management. This position can be based in any J&J MT office location in NJ or MA (preferred locations include Raritan). The User Access Management (UAM) Analyst will be supporting the MedTech ERP Operate State team and governing the E2E Supply Chain business processes for UAM in our MedTech ERP ecosystem. The individual will support a multi-year global business transformation initiative to update end-to-end Supply Chain digital capabilities by harmonizing 40+ major global MT ERP systems, standardizing core business processes and products, and enabling a coordinated data strategy through a single SAP S/4 HANA instance. The MT SC UAM Analyst will govern and support End User Access requests for all MedTech S/4 HANA ERP Systems with Good Practices (GxP) will be the primary area of focus. This includes reviewing, approving, and assigning mitigations to users based on the access requested and our mitigation library. The candidate will participate in various security role design sessions to ensure security roles are crafted with best practice principles in mind. The role will also provide support in reporting and socializing compliance management activity performance metrics, and participate in Operate State leadership SOD performance review sessions. This role will provide UAM support for ongoing access requests in addition to all future go lives and incoming new users throughout the business functional teams live on MedTech ERP SAP S4 HANA. Key Responsibilities: Leverage available security provisioning tools, eg. GRC and IGA, to review, approve, mitigate end users in MedTech global ERP.
